Police Appeal To Find Man Missing From Canley Heights

Police are appealing for public assistance to locate a man reported missing from Sydney's south-west.

Graeme Clark, aged 40, was last seen in Canley Heights, about 8am Monday (21 April 2025).

When he could not be located or contacted, officers attached to Fairfield City Police Area Command were notified and commenced inquiries into his whereabouts.

Police and family hold concerns for Graeme's welfare due to a number of health conditions.

He is described as being of Caucasian appearance, 170cm – 175cm tall and 100kg – 110kg with a large build, fair complexion, black shaven head, and unshaven facial hair.

Graeme is known to frequent the Canley Vale area.

Anyone with information into his whereabouts is urged to contact Fairfield Police or Crime Stoppers on 1800 333 000.
